If you find yourself bottlenecked on IO performance, OrbStack is the best. Also a fan of the fact that it has a very similar VM function to WSL2. Also supports using either Rosetta or Qemu for emulation of Intel architecture, and has some kind of Kubernetes integration that I didn't try. Last I tried Podman Desktop, it was OK, but had worse performance than Docker and was a little rougher around the edges. Still, not bad. Colima is probably fine, but I had issues that were showstoppers for me. Trying to get it to consistently start up correctly in a CI environment seemed oddly challenging, and it doesn't seem to support IPv6 at all. YMMV. Have not tried Rancher Desktop. |
